Emergency responders rushed to the scene of a severe incident involving a pedestrian and a recycling truck in San Francisco. The victim sustained life-threatening injuries and was immediately transported to a nearby hospital. Authorities have launched a comprehensive investigation to uncover the precise factors contributing to the collision. Preliminary statements suggest that visibility issues and the complicated urban street layout may have played a role. Witnesses reported that the incident occurred during the morning rush hour, compounding the challenges faced by both the pedestrian and the truck driver.

In light of this tragic event, safety specialists emphasize the critical need for enhanced protective measures to safeguard vulnerable road users. Key recommendations include:

  • Improved pedestrian crosswalks with clearer markings and better lighting
  • Expanded use of vehicle blind spot detection technologies on large trucks
  • Public awareness campaigns focusing on pedestrian and driver vigilance
  • Stricter enforcement of speed limits in busy urban corridors
